On Mon 2009-03-02 23:42:52, Marcin Slusarz wrote:
> This virtual device can be used to tell user space about periods of time
> when user didn't "touch" input devices (keyboards, mice, touchpads, joysticks,
> etc). For now it supports only keyboard events.
>
> Notification is done through simple select/poll + ioctl interface.
>
> It can be used to implement screen savers, automatic suspend,
> autoaway/autodisconnect (e.g. in instant messangers) without
> any help from X server and its overhead (context switches).
I don't think this is good interface; what if you have more than one
seat? And without mouse handling it is useless anyway, so....
